Defining Social Gaming Networks

A social gaming network is a digital ecosystem that combines interactive entertainment with social connectivity. These platforms allow users to play games, share progress, invite friends, and collaborate in real time. The core distinction from conventional gaming lies in the emphasis on social interaction rather than isolated gameplay. Popular examples include mobile-based networks where users compete for high scores, browser-based worlds where players build communities, and dedicated platforms that aggregate multiple games under one social umbrella. The design of these networks prioritizes accessibility, often featuring simple mechanics and short play sessions to accommodate casual users.

Key Features and Mechanisms

Central to social gaming networks is the concept of the "social graph"—a digital map of a user's connections. These networks leverage existing relationships to enhance engagement. Features such as gifting virtual items, sharing progress on external feeds, and competing on daily or weekly leaderboards create a loop of interaction. Rewards are often tied to social actions; for example, a user might receive in-game currency for inviting a friend or assisting a neighbor in a virtual world. This design encourages organic growth and retention, as each active user becomes a potential recruiter. Additionally, many platforms implement progression systems that reward consistent logins and social participation, reinforcing habitual use.

Community Building and User Retention

One of the most powerful aspects of social gaming networks is their ability to build lasting communities. Features like chat rooms, forums, and in-game clans or guilds transform casual players into invested community members. Regular events, seasonal tournaments, and collaborative challenges strengthen these bonds. For instance, a network might host a cooperative event where players work together to unlock collective rewards, fostering a sense of shared purpose. Research indicates that users who form social connections on these platforms tend to stay active longer and spend more time engaging with the ecosystem. This community-driven retention is a key metric for network success.

Monetization Models

Social gaming networks employ various monetization strategies that do not involve traditional wagering. Common methods include the sale of virtual goods, such as cosmetic items, power-ups, or exclusive content; subscription tiers that offer premium features; and advertising revenues from sponsored content or video ads integrated into gameplay. Another prevalent model is the "freemium" approach, where the basic service is free, but users may choose to purchase enhancements. These microtransactions are often designed to be optional, ensuring that the core experience remains accessible to all users regardless of spending. The ethics of these models are frequently debated, particularly concerning younger audiences, leading to calls for transparent pricing and spending limits.

Technological Foundations

Behind every social gaming network lies a sophisticated technical infrastructure. Cloud computing enables real-time synchronization across devices, allowing users to switch from mobile to desktop without losing progress. Real-time messaging protocols support instant communication between players, while matchmaking algorithms pair users with similar skill levels or interests. Scalability is crucial, as networks must handle sudden spikes in user activity during events. Security measures, including encryption and authentication protocols, protect user accounts and financial transactions. As technology evolves, integration with augmented reality and virtual reality promises to deepen immersion and social presence within these networks.

Regulatory and Ethical Considerations

As social gaming networks grow in popularity, they have attracted increased regulatory scrutiny. Concerns over user privacy, data protection, and the potential for excessive engagement have led to new guidelines in many jurisdictions. Some regions require networks to implement features that promote healthy usage, such as session time reminders and activity dashboards. Age verification mechanisms are also becoming standard to protect minors. Industry self-regulation, through codes of conduct and best practices, aims to preempt stricter government intervention. Responsible operators recognize that long-term success depends on maintaining user trust and welfare.
